It's Michael's thirty-fifth birthday, and his friends are coming over to celebrate, for better or worse, as he grieves over his advancing age in a youth-obsessed culture, and also over his inability to find a smart gay comedy with nudity to fill his small theatre company's bank account. And his late-arriving surprise birthday present will just make it all worse. Much worse. Head Games takes pot shots at pop culture at the turn of the new century and at itself, and it doubles back on itself structurally, playing the story out of chronology - so that as Act II opens, you realize that much of what you thought happened in Act I isn't what it appeared...
